
<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E wml PUBLIC "-//WAPFORUM//DTD WML 1.1//EN" "http://www.wapforum.org/DTD/wml_1.1.xml">
<wml>
	<head><meta forua="true" http-equiv="Cache-Control" content="max-age=0" /></head><card id="MainCard" title="&#x6B22;&#x8FCE;&#x5149;&#x4E34;"><p><a href="wap.asp">&#x6728;&#x5B50;&#x5C4B;</a><br/>&nbsp;</p><p><b>&#x6807;&#x9898;&#x3A;</b> &#x43;&#x23;&#x533F;&#x540D;&#x5BF9;&#x8C61;&#x8F6C;&#x4E3A;&#x96C6;&#x5408;</p><p><b>&#x4F5C;&#x8005;&#x3A;</b> &#x64;&#x6E;&#x61;&#x77;&#x6F;</p><p><b>&#x65E5;&#x671F;&#x3A;</b> &#x32;&#x30;&#x31;&#x33;&#x2D;&#x30;&#x35;&#x2D;&#x32;&#x32;&#x20;&#x30;&#x36;&#x3A;&#x33;&#x35;&#x20;&#x50;&#x4D;</p><p><b>&#x5206;&#x7C7B;&#x3A;</b> <a href="wap.asp?do=showLog&amp;cateID=16">&#x57;&#x69;&#x6E;&#x7F16;&#x7A0B;</a></p><p><b>&#x5185;&#x5BB9;&#x3A;</b> &#x4ECA;&#x5929;&#x505A;&#x4E00;&#x4E2A;&#x63A5;&#x53E3;&#x65F6;&#xFF0C;&#x8981;&#x6C42;&#x8FD4;&#x56DE;&#x6570;&#x636E;&#x7C7B;&#x578B;&#x4E3A;json&#x5BF9;&#x8C61;&#x6570;&#x7EC4;&#xFF0C;&#x4F46;&#x670D;&#x52A1;&#x5668;&#x7AEF;&#x5904;&#x7406;&#x540E;&#x5F97;&#x5230;&#x7684;&#x662F;&#x4E00;&#x4E2A;&#x533F;&#x540D;&#x5BF9;&#x8C61;&#xFF0C;&#x4F8B;&#x5982;&#xFF1A;<br/>&#x590D;&#x5236;&#x5185;&#x5BB9;&#x5230;&#x526A;&#x8D34;&#x677F; &#x7A0B;&#x5E8F;&#x4EE3;&#x7801;var detail = new { PayOut = 50, InCome = 100 };<br/>&#x5C1D;&#x8BD5;&#x7528;dynamic&#x5173;&#x952E;&#x5B57;&#xFF0C;&#x6D4B;&#x8BD5;&#x53EF;&#x4EE5;&#x5B9E;&#x73B0;&#x9700;&#x6C42;&#xFF0C;&#x4EE3;&#x7801;&#x5982;&#x4E0B;&#xFF1A;<br/>&#x590D;&#x5236;&#x5185;&#x5BB9;&#x5230;&#x526A;&#x8D34;&#x677F; &#x7A0B;&#x5E8F;&#x4EE3;&#x7801;using (testContext context = new testContext())<br/>{<br/>&nbsp;&nbsp;&nbsp;&nbsp;DateTime date1 = DateTime.Parse(&#34;2013-05-20&#34;);<br/>&nbsp;&nbsp;&nbsp;&nbsp;DateTime date2 = DateTime.Parse(&#34;2013-05-27&#34;);<br/>&nbsp;&nbsp;&nbsp;&nbsp;var details = context.AdDetails.Wh&#101;re(d =&gt; d.Cr&#101;ated &gt;= date1 &amp;&amp; d.Cr&#101;ated &lt; date2);<br/>&nbsp;&nbsp;&nbsp;&nbsp;var detail = new { PayOut = details.Sum(item =&gt; item.PayOut), InCome = details.Sum(item =&gt; item.InCome) };<br/>&nbsp;&nbsp;&nbsp;&nbsp;var data = new List&lt;dynamic&gt;() { detail };<br/>&nbsp;&nbsp;&nbsp;&nbsp;Console.WriteLine(new Javascri&#112;tSerializer().Serialize(data));<br/>}<br/>&#x540E;&#x6765;&#x5BF9;Linq&#x8FDB;&#x884C;&#x6784;&#x9020;&#xFF0C;&#x4E00;&#x6837;&#x53EF;&#x4EE5;&#x5B8C;&#x6210;&#xFF1A;<br/>&#x590D;&#x5236;&#x5185;&#x5BB9;&#x5230;&#x526A;&#x8D34;&#x677F; &#x7A0B;&#x5E8F;&#x4EE3;&#x7801;using (testContext context = new testContext())<br/>{<br/>&nbsp;&nbsp;&nbsp;&nbsp;DateTime date1 = DateTime.Parse(&#34;2013-05-20&#34;);<br/>&nbsp;&nbsp;&nbsp;&nbsp;DateTime date2 = DateTime.Parse(&#34;2013-05-27&#34;);<br/>&nbsp;&nbsp;&nbsp;&nbsp;var data = context.AdDetails.Wh&#101;re(d =&gt; d.Cr&#101;ated &gt;= date1 &amp;&amp; d.Cr&#101;ated &lt; date2).ToList()<br/>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;.Sel&#101;ct(d =&gt; new { PayOut = d.PayOut, InCome = d.InCome, Group = 1 })<br/>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;.GroupBy(d =&gt; d.Group) //&#x5173;&#x952E;&#x70B9;<br/>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;.Sel&#101;ct(g =&gt; new { PayOut = g.Sum(item =&gt; item.PayOut), InCome = g.Sum(item =&gt; item.InCome) });<br/>&nbsp;&nbsp;&nbsp;&nbsp;Console.WriteLine(new Javascri&#112;tSerializer().Serialize(data));<br/>}<br/>&#x5BF9;&#x5E94;SQL&#x8BED;&#x53E5;&#x4E3A;&#xFF1A;<br/>&#x590D;&#x5236;&#x5185;&#x5BB9;&#x5230;&#x526A;&#x8D34;&#x677F; &#x7A0B;&#x5E8F;&#x4EE3;&#x7801;sel&#101;ct SUM(PayOut) PayOut, SUM(InCome) InCome from AdDetail wh&#101;re Cr&#101;ated&gt;=&#39;2013-05-20&#39; and Cr&#101;ated&lt;&#39;2013-05-27&#39;</p><p> + <a href="#CommentCard">&#x67E5;&#x770B;&#x5F53;&#x524D;&#x65E5;&#x5FD7;&#x8BC4;&#x8BBA;</a> (0)</p><p>&nbsp;<br/><br/><a href="wap.asp?do=Login">&#x767B;&#x5F55;</a></p><p><br/>&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;</p><p><a href="wap.asp">&#x6728;&#x5B50;&#x5C4B;</a></p><p><a href="http://www.pjhome.net/wap.asp">PJBlog3&nbsp;v3.2.9.518</a>&nbsp;Inside.</p><p>Processed&nbsp;In&nbsp;0.031&nbsp;ms</p><do type="prev" label="&#x8FD4;&#x56DE;"><prev/></do></card><card id="postCommentCard"><p><b>&#x6807;&#x9898;&#x3A;</b> <a href="#MainCard">&#x43;&#x23;&#x533F;&#x540D;&#x5BF9;&#x8C61;&#x8F6C;&#x4E3A;&#x96C6;&#x5408;</a></p><p><br/>你没有权限发表评论</p><p><br/>&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;</p><p><a href="wap.asp">&#x6728;&#x5B50;&#x5C4B;</a></p><p><a href="http://www.pjhome.net/wap.asp">PJBlog3&nbsp;v3.2.9.518</a>&nbsp;Inside.</p><p>Processed&nbsp;In&nbsp;0.031&nbsp;ms</p><do type="prev" label="&#x8FD4;&#x56DE;"><prev/></do></card><card id="CommentCard"><p>&#x6682;&#x65E0;&#x8BC4;&#x8BBA;</p><p><a href="#MainCard">&#x8FD4;&#x56DE;</a></p><p><br/>&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;&#x2500;</p><p><a href="wap.asp">&#x6728;&#x5B50;&#x5C4B;</a></p><p><a href="http://www.pjhome.net/wap.asp">PJBlog3&nbsp;v3.2.9.518</a>&nbsp;Inside.</p><p>Processed&nbsp;In&nbsp;0.031&nbsp;ms</p><do type="prev" label="&#x8FD4;&#x56DE;"><prev/></do></card>
</wml>
